V305W Losing Wireless Link

I just bought (a couple months ago) a Dell Laptop/Printer package.  The printer is a V305W, the laptop is a Studio 1555.  I'm running Windows 7.

I have the habit of leaving the laptop on, but the cover closed (which would put it in sleep mode).  Every once in a while, when trying to print, the printer appears to not be connected.  Restarting the laptop reconnects and everything is fine, until the next time it happens.  It's highly annoying, especially after doing a couple hours of research on the web and deciding to print the results only to find that I have to reboot and restart the research.

Has anyone else had this problem and have you a solution?

 Clif001,

 

Try using these little tweaks on the laptop and see how it helps.

 

 

Go to device manager(right click my computer, left click properties, left click hardware, left click device manager)


Go to the USB Controller section and click the + sign.


Go to each USB Root Hub and right click on it, left click properties, left click power management. Uncheck the box, allow computer to turn off this device to save power.


Restart your computer.

--------------------------------------

Go to device manager(right click my computer, left click properties, left click hardware, left click device manager). Click on Network and then right click on your wireless adapter, left click properties, power management. Uncheck the box, allow computer to turn off this device to save power.
